Moreover, the psychology of rewards plays an essential role in gambling. Variable ratio reinforcement, where players receive rewards at unpredictable intervals, leads to higher engagement and can create a compulsive gaming behavior. This method mirrors the operations of slot machines, where the uncertainty of winning keeps players spinning the reels in hopes of hitting the jackpot. Understanding these psychological mechanisms is crucial for both designers and players, as they can significantly influence outcomes and behaviors.

Interactivity and Engagement Mechanics
Interactivity is a key element in game design that significantly influences player engagement in gambling. By allowing players to make choices and interact with various elements of the game, designers create a more immersive experience. Features such as customizable avatars or interactive bonus rounds enhance the player's emotional investment in the game, leading to prolonged playtime and increased spending. The more engaged players feel, the more likely they are to continue participating.
Furthermore, the incorporation of skill-based elements can appeal to a different demographic of players. Games that require strategy or decision-making can attract those who might be less interested in purely chance-based gambling. By blending skill with chance, these mechanics can create a more dynamic experience that appeals to a broader audience. This shift in focus not only impacts individual player behavior but also shapes the future of gambling as a whole.
Another important factor is how feedback mechanisms are integrated into the game design. Immediate feedback on player actions, such as visual and auditory cues when winning or losing, can heighten emotional responses. This immediacy can amplify excitement and anxiety, driving players to continue engaging with the game. Effective use of feedback keeps players focused and can lead to a more satisfying gaming experience, reinforcing their behaviors within the gambling environment.
The Impact of Visual and Auditory Cues
Visual and auditory cues are powerful tools in game design that can significantly affect player behavior in gambling. Bright colors, dynamic animations, and exciting sound effects can create an immersive atmosphere that heightens excitement and anticipation. These sensory elements can alter a player’s perception of the game, making wins feel more significant and losses less impactful, which can lead to increased playtime and spending.
Moreover, the synchronization of visual and auditory cues plays a crucial role in reinforcing behavior. When players win, accompanying celebratory sounds and animations create a positive feedback loop, encouraging them to keep playing. This design technique capitalizes on emotional responses, making players more likely to return to the game in pursuit of that euphoric experience. Such a combination ultimately shapes how players perceive their gambling experience.
In addition, the use of themes and narratives in gambling games can further engage players. Story-driven games or those with unique artistic styles can create a more profound connection with players. When players invest emotionally in a storyline, they are more inclined to continue playing, hoping to achieve specific outcomes. This narrative engagement not only enhances the enjoyment of the game but also influences spending habits and overall player behavior.
The Role of Technology in Shaping Player Experience
Technological advancements have drastically transformed game design and player behavior in gambling. The rise of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ies has created new opportunities for immersive experiences. These technologies allow players to engage in realistic environments that replicate physical casinos or create entirely new gaming worlds. This heightened immersion can lead to increased engagement and altered perceptions of time spent gambling.
Additionally, the integration of data analytics in game design offers a deeper understanding of player behavior. By analyzing player patterns and preferences, designers can tailor experiences to meet specific audience needs, optimizing engagement. Personalization, driven by data, not only enhances player satisfaction but also encourages loyalty and repeat visits. By understanding what makes players tick, game designers can create environments that keep them coming back for more.
Furthermore, mobile technology has also reshaped how players interact with gambling games. With the convenience of playing anywhere at any time, players are more likely to engage with games frequently. Mobile apps often incorporate game design elements that foster quick interactions and immediate rewards, keeping players engaged. This shift towards mobile platforms signals a future trend in gambling, where accessibility and convenience become paramount in influencing player behavior.
